The Johns Hopkins Bayview Primary Care Internal Medicine Residency Program provides a comprehensive and innovative learning experience to develop future healers and leaders in primary care medicine. Our program graduates are prepared to practice evidence-based, patient-centered primary care medicine for all patients across diverse ...

The Multidisciplinary Empowerment for Sustainable Health program (MESH) is designed to engage and empower patients to reach their healthcare goals with patient driven holistic care plans. The aim is to assist patients in transitioning their care out of the hospital and emergency department and into our primary care practice.Johns Hopkins Bayview Medical Center. 4940 Eastern Avenue, Suite 1100, Baltimore, MD 21224; phone: 410-550-3350; fax: 410-550-0491; Expertise. ... The Johns Hopkins Bayview Internal Medicine Residency Program accepts applications through the Electronic Residency Application Service (ERAS). We do not accept any information submitted outside of ERAS. The Bayview MICU team cares for a 12-bed unit and consists of a pulmonary/critical care attending, a pulmonary/critical care fellow, two junior residents from the Osler Program, and two junior or senior residents from the Bayview Internal Medicine Residency. Formally established in 2013 at Johns Hopkins Bayview, Medicine for the Greater Good is an initiative and formal curriculum that seeks to train and educate medical residents in bridging the gap in health disparities between the hospital and the community. RBMG is the primary outpatient practice for medicine residents in the Johns Hopkins Bayview Internal Medicine Residency.
